verb

  1. To nag persistently.
    “But—Oh! ye lords of ladies intellectual, Inform us truly, have they not hen-peck'd you all?”
    “He wears a beard, and he likes his women to be slaves. What man doesn’t? What man would be henpecked, I say? We will cut off all the heads in Christendom or Turkeydom rather than that.”
    “I don't want to hen-peck you ! Hen-pecking is shocking bad taste. But I won't be a slighted, neglected wife; I have a spirit of my own, and I won't meekly submit to be ignored.”
    “Well, one never hears a woman boast that she henpecks her husband, even though there are many, for the reason that she realizes it is wrong.”
    “We have friends who thought it was cute when their daughter "hen-pecked" her husband. But, when their son married a spicy little gal who tried to hen-peck their son, they were very angry.”
  2. to peck or peck at another bird.
    “Mrs Allsop and her bar-blue brother travelled well together in good times, but after they ducketed she would chase him from niche to niche, henpecking him while Monte tried to collar them and collect their rings.”

noun

  1. (rare)A man who is meekly subservient to his wife.
    “One can't swear that Dewan Bahadur Yama Dharma Rao was a henpeck ; nor could be said that the practical Lady was a cockpeck.”
    “The moment he allows the emphasis to swing the other way he becomes a sit-by-the-fire, a cockerel, a drone, a henpeck. A woman steps into this man's sphere at her peril.”

Etymology

From hen + peck.
